UK Immigration Update: Reminder to Employers on No-Deal and Deal Brexit Immigration Plans

Morgan Lewis | | Return|
Employers should review the proposals setting out no-deal Brexit plans, immigration plans if the United Kingdom does adopt the proposals set out in the withdrawal agreement, and related considerations....
